Nice. :biggrin: As in, what my GCSE subjects were or...? :smile: I'm currently on a gap year after doing my A-Levels, will be starting university in October.

Hmm...advice... :tongue: It may sound cheesy but try to take every opportunity that you can. I wish I went to loads of events that were organised, (for example prom after Year 11, the ball after Year 13) but sadly couldn't because I needed to travel abroad both times. It can help reduce your stress levels and help pass time both before and after exams when you need it.

In terms of exams and revision, just try your best! There's nothing more you can do than your best and if you do work hard, there is no reason as to why you can't achieve the grades that you want. It's normal to feel nervous and being a bit nervous is a good thing but try not to let the level of nervousness increase to a level that makes life much harder for you. I'd also suggest taking time out to do things that you love just to help keep your stress levels low. I think that doing that is just as important as revision - you don't need to work 24/7 to achieve good grades, rest is just as important.

There are so many different revision techniques people have. There isn't one technique that is best for everyone but see if you can experiment around to see which one works best for you. :smile:
